About Shaw Ridge Primary School

Shaw Ridge Primary School sits almost exactly on the Swindon local authority average for the key stage 2 combined expected standard in reading, writing and maths, with 62% of pupils hitting that benchmark against a LA average of 62%. That places it 26th out of 51 primary schools in the area, squarely in the middle of the pack. Where the school does nudge ahead is in maths: 79% of pupils reached the expected standard, and the average maths score of 106 is solid. Reading and writing both sit at 76% for expected standards, again in line with what you’d expect locally. The proportion of pupils reaching the higher standard across all three subjects is 17%, which is respectable but not exceptional. With 11.6% of pupils eligible for free school meals, the school serves a broadly representative intake, and its results suggest it delivers consistent, middle-of-the-road outcomes without dramatic highs or lows.
